This thrash metal band from Hokkaido started as Nigarobo in 1989 but eventually turned to Negarobo after releasing their third demo in 1996… read moreThis thrash metal band from Hokkaido started as Nigarobo in 1989 but eventually turned to Negarobo after releasing their third demo in 1996. "Emergency" is their first and only full-length studio album. A speed/thrash metal-band from Tokyo, Japan. Formed in 1985, they appeared on the split-LP named "Far East Thrash Army - Thrash Live i… read moreA speed/thrash metal-band from Tokyo, Japan. Formed in 1985, they appeared on the split-LP named "Far East Thrash Army - Thrash Live in Savagery" (1989), together with Genoa, Drastic Gunsmith, Shell Shock and Vietnam.
